WILKES-BARRE, PA (April 27, 2024) -- In their Middle Atlantic Conference Freedom (MAC Freedom) finale on Saturday afternoon, the King's College women's tennis team fell to top-ranked Stevens, 8-0, with an unfinished doubles match at Kirby Park. The Monarchs fall to 6-10 overall and 1-5 in the standings, while the Ducks improved to 11-5 and an unbeaten 6-0 in the MAC Freedom.

At No. 1 singles,
Ashley Kenia fell by scores of 6-1 and 6-0 to Stephanie Untermeyer, while
Hailey D'Amato dropped sets of 6-0 and 6-2 at No. 2 singles to Julianna Gomez. The No. 3 singles match saw
Jackie Costello drop a pair of 6-3 sets to Julia Chiovitti, while
Carlee Dellose lost by sets of 6-1 and 6-0 to Lorena Piegas at No. 4 singles.
Emma Rooney was downed by matching 6-0 sets to Anya Sharma at No. 5 singles, while
Sarah Stettler faced setbacks of 6-0 and 6-2 to Aliona Heitz at No. 6 singles.

At No. 1 doubles, Kenia and D'Amato battled before falling, 8-7 (1-0), to the Ducks pair, while Costello and Dellose lost, 8-1, at No. 2 doubles. Rooney and
Anagrace Schwartz were trailing, 7-4, before the match was called at No. 3 doubles.
